How to Get a Visa for Attending the China Canton Fair from India

The China Canton Fair (China Import and Export Fair) is one of the world’s largest and most influential trade exhibitions, attracting thousands of Indian business owners, importers, exporters, and manufacturers every year. If you are planning to attend the Canton Fair from India, obtaining the correct China business visa (M Visa) is a crucial step.

This guide explains the complete visa process, documents required, and important tips to help Indian travelers apply smoothly.

What Type of Visa Is Required for the Canton Fair?

Indian citizens must apply for a China Business Visa (M Visa) to attend the Canton Fair.
Tourist visas are not accepted for trade fair participation.

Step-by-Step Process to Get a China Canton Fair Visa from India

1. Register for the Canton Fair

Before applying for the visa, you must register on the official Canton Fair website and obtain:

  • Invitation Letter (mandatory)
  • Buyer Badge confirmation (online or onsite)

The invitation letter is issued by the Canton Fair authorities and is the most important document for visa approval.

2. Gather Required Documents

You will need the following documents for a China business visa from India:

  • Original passport (minimum 6 months validity, at least 2 blank pages)
  • Completed China visa application form
  • Recent passport-size photograph (white background)
  • Canton Fair invitation letter (PDF or printed copy)
  • Proof of business (GST certificate / Company registration / Visiting card)
  • Covering letter on company letterhead
  • Travel itinerary (flight details)
  • Hotel booking confirmation
  • Previous China visa copy (if any)

China visa applications from India are submitted through the Chinese Visa Application Service Center (CVASC) in cities like:

  • New Delhi
  • Mumbai
  • Chennai
  • Kolkata

Biometrics (fingerprints) may be required depending on your travel history and visa type.

4. Visa Processing Time

  • Normal processing: 5–7 working days
  • Express processing: 2–3 working days (subject to availability)

Processing time may vary during peak Canton Fair seasons (April & October), so early application is highly recommended.

5. Receive Your Visa & Travel

Once the authorities approve your visa, they will stamp your passport with the China M Visa. Consequently, you can attend the Canton Fair and, at the same time, legally conduct business activities during your stay in China.

Important Tips for Indian Travelers

  • Apply at least 3–4 weeks before travel
  • Ensure company details match across all documents
  • Invitation letter must clearly mention your name and passport number
  • Carry printed copies of hotel bookings and return tickets
  • Be prepared to explain your business purpose if asked

1. What is the Canton Fair in China?

The Canton Fair, also known as the China Import and Export Fair, is the largest trade exhibition in China. It is held twice a year in Guangzhou and attracts global buyers and manufacturers.

2. When is the China Canton Fair held?

The organizers usually hold the Canton Fair in April (Spring session) and October (Autumn session) each year. Moreover, they divide each session into multiple phases based on product categories.

3. What visa is required to attend the Canton Fair from India?

Indian citizens must apply for a China Business Visa (M Visa). This visa allows you to attend the Canton Fair and legally engage in business-related activities during your stay.
